Weaknesses:
- Lack of BIM/Modern Tech: You won't find Building Information Modeling (BIM), 3D printing construction, or advanced green building materials in older editions.
- Outdated Codes: Some older PDF versions reference old IS codes (Indian Standards). Always cross-check with the latest IS 456 (Plain and Reinforced Concrete) or IS 875 (Load standards).
5. Modern Trends in Building Construction
- Green Building – Use of sustainable materials, rainwater harvesting, solar panels, and energy-efficient designs (LEED, GRIHA rating).
- Prefabrication – Factory-made components (walls, slabs, stairs) reduce time and waste.
- Building Information Modeling (BIM) – 3D digital modeling for coordination and lifecycle management.
- High-performance concrete – Self-compacting, high-strength, and fiber-reinforced concrete.
- Smart buildings – Integrated sensors, automation, and IoT for lighting, security, and climate control.
